How they compare

Burundi currently reports 2.01 international-$ in 2021 prices against 1.68 international-$ in 2021 prices in Zambia, a difference of 0.33 international-$ in 2021 prices.

That makes Burundi's figure about 1.2 times Zambia's.

Burundi ranks 117th and Zambia ranks 119th of 120 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Burundi averaged higher in 1 and Zambia in 1.
